Yes, a rusted chase cover is one of the most common reasons chases start leaking, and we swap it for a properly fitted cover that sheds water and keeps the rest of the structure dry. If you're already dealing with rust streaks down the side, we'll take care of the cause and the staining together.

Watch for rust stains, peeling or gapping siding, water marks near the top, or a cover that's holding puddles, our humidity, salt air, and storm-driven rain wear chases down fast. If you're seeing any of that, it's worth a quick look before the water reaches the inside.
